Nahiri, the Harbinger feels very good, Selfeisek was right. Smoothes the draws, exiles creatures, enchantments and artifacts(really important right now) and has a "get a Reveler NOW" button if you need gas. Liliana of the Veil feels really good too in a meta with Phoenix and GDS. Now that go-wide creature decks are being hunted by UR Phoenix, I feel she has a place in the mainboard again. She's as deadly against combo and decks with few threats as ever. And Hazoret the Fervent is almost imposible to remove if you don't have exile options. I haven't regretted replacing one 1 mana discard for a threat at all.
I've been considering Kalitas, Traitor of Ghet as an extra threat that's hard to remove for red, and that hoses graveyard strategies while being good at stabilizing our life total. I feel sometimes that the deck lacks a way to gain life reliably. Maybe Timely Reinforcements or even Baneslayer Angel could work as they're pretty good against heavy aggro metas. UW uses these, and while they're way slower, the plan of stripping away their resources and slowing the game to a crawl should synergize with these cards too.

We were 8 and everyone played against everyone.
My result was 6-1 ( 6 wins - 1 loss)
Matchups:
Griselbrand 2-0 (first game 4 Discards did the work, second game pretty much the same)
UB Mill 2-1 (All Matches pretty close, the long game favors Mill as well, but the losing game was closer than the winning ones, Bedlam was the key)
Dredge 2-1 (First game was close but lost, than Rakdos Charm won me the second game, third game he didn't drew is third land so i was fast enough)
UR Storm 0-2 (First game was lacking discard, second kept a greedy hand, too less lands, and was punished for it)
UR Storm 2-1 (First game: not enough removal for his creatures, second and third were easy because of extirpate and rakdos charm, his only reamaining win option were goblin token,rest was taken by extirpate or discarded)
Affinity 2-0 (he was an unexperienced player so not really a problem and had enough removel and blood moon for creature lands)
Jund 2-0 (Chandra with some pyromancer blockers won me the first game, very close, second game was way easier because of early blood moon, he had no basics so no way of removing it fast enough)
Smoldering Marsh is in the deck for blackleaf Cliffs(too expensive) but it rewards for searching basics
Shambling vents is rarely important but can get back some life
Ghost quarter/field of ruins - sometimes they are too restrictive, but you can use them to get basics (ghosting an own lands feels bad but can get you the needed color), and sometimes they are just perfect(against Tron, Manlands)
Blackmail or second Thoughtseize, i was chooseing blackmail because budget and it can get lands (most of the time you only want to use it if he has 3 or less cards)
anguished unmaking didn't do much, was thinking about 1 Carniaval/Carnage or another discard (Thoughtseize)
Chandra/Nahiri can win games on their own and provide nice utility, most of the times Chandra is favorable but sometimes Nahiri's exiling is very important.
Hazoret is a nice threat mainboard and if we need to speed up, there are two Goblin Rabblemester in the sideboard, was thinking about legion warboss split but i prefer the higher output from rabblemaster if unchecked.
Kambal is wonderful against any spellbased decks won me some games on his own (against mill or storm)
Rakdos Charm i like because of his flexibility and it's a spell (compared to Nihil spellbomb or Leyline)
Extirpate is needed for the Combo/Graveyard decks and can be pretty good against a "mirror-match" (Grixis,Mardu)
Anger of the Gods - much cheaper then EE and it's a spell for Bedlam, and exiles them, really important against Izzet Phoenix and dredge

Yeah, speaking of RNA. Have you found any card that could be good?
I've found nothing. First i was liking light up the stage, but what does it replace really, i cant find anything worth taking out.
Then Rix Maadi Reveler is interesting but the same thing there, Bedlam Reveler is way better. Rix Maadi Reveler is easier to cast if we face GY hate but if we do get to cast Bedlam Reveler, its superior in every way, cheaper, bigger and with prowess.
Maybe if we changed our pool to more white in the future, Kayas Wrath could be a thing to save ourselfs if someone is racing us and winning, since we can get some hp from our creatures while destroying everything.
One card though that i want to try in SB against big creatures is Pestilent Priest, could be really fun to bolt a Deaths Shadow.
The only positive thing i guess is cheaper Godless Shrine
For sure Bedlam Reveler is much better than Rix Maadi Reveler. But how about use Rix Maadi Reveler as the 5th and/or 6th Bedlam Reveler for the deck? Surely would help with the gas (which is not really a big problem for the deck though). I don't really think that he's good enough, but I think that if we would try him, he would probably fit the role of being the 5th or 6th Reveler.
Light up the Stage could be a good draw spell IMO. It costs less than Night's Whisper (which only a few lists play) and doesn't do any damage for us. The problem is the Spectacle clause. In it's hard cast, Light up the Stage is a bad card. In Spectacle mode, it's really good. Maybe one or two copys? If it gets clunky, we might just discard them for Looting or Brutality.
Its worth testing, maybe it can be good.
The backdraw is if we find Lingering souls or Bedlam reveler and have no mana to cast them, then they are exiled and cant be used or retrieved with kolaghans or Ltlh.
I think Luts is better for aggro decks that will be able to cast everything they find with it.
